Approximate determination of stress intensity factor for multiple surface cracks [PDF]

open access: yesFME Transactions, 2018
In this paper a versatile and easy to use approximate procedure was used for the estimation of mode I stress intensity factors in case of multiple surface cracks in a three dimensional elastic body, subjected to remote uniaxial tensile loading.

RIPK4 function interferes with melanoma cell adhesion and metastasis

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
RIPK4 promotes melanoma growth and spread. RIPK4 levels increase as skin lesions progress to melanoma. CRISPR/Cas9‐mediated deletion of RIPK4 causes melanoma cells to form less compact spheroids, reduces their migratory and invasive abilities and limits tumour growth and dissemination in mouse models.
